Five Steps To Becoming Effective

Assuming that you are signed up to the idea of becoming more effective then how do you go about it? Here are five steps to becoming effective.

STEP ONE – SET THE GOAL / OBJECTIVE

Without this you are lost. You need to very carefully consider what is your ultimate goal or objective. Why are you as an individual or organisation doing what you are doing? Before moving on you need to finalise the goal and also your timescale for achieving it.

STEP TWO – WHAT DO YOU NEED TO DO TO GET TO YOUR GOAL?

Now we have the ultimate goal, how are we going to get there? What are the steps you need to achieve along the way? Setting a timeline with measurable goals along the way is the only way forward. These goals need to be achievable and the timescales need to be reasonably short, Monthly or Quarterly is best.

STEP THREE – MEASURE PROGRESS

Any goal you set must be measurable. Although you will have short term milestones you need to measure progress along the way, daily or weekly. Set in place systems to enable you to measure progress and to adapt and change as external problems try to push you off course. Make sure you review everything regularly.

STEP FOUR – DO FIRST THINGS FIRST

Every day ensure that you do those things that move you toward your goal first and everything else afterwards. The Ivy Lee Method will really help here and you need to plan your day around this.

STEP FIVE – SHARE THE GOAL

If you are in an organisation then the ultimate goal needs to be shared with everyone in the organisation. If you don’t do this then don’t complain when people do things that send the organisation off course. If you are doing it as an individual then share the goal with others. There is nothing like making your goal public to ensure that you really work toward it.

A journey of one thousand miles starts with one step but make sure that step is in the right direction.
